Chris Moyles started his broadcasting career at the age of 16, working for Aire FM in Leeds and then onto Radio Luxembourg and London’s Capital FM. Here, the DJ takes you on a journey from his idyllic childhood in Leeds, through his discovery of radio and onto his new found fame as ‘the saviour’ of BBC Radio One.

Motor mouth. Loud Mouth. Tubby DJ. Overpaid ego.

What is the truth? Who is Chris Moyles? And what does he have to say for himself when he’s not on the radio? Who is this man they call ‘The Saviour of Radio 1’?

In The Gospel According to Chris Moyles, Chris dissects the world around him and tackles all sorts of subjects; from interviewing the world’s most famous celebrities, to trying to find a parking space in his own street.

But you’ll also get to meet his family and friends and learn about how he went from teenage DJ on a psychiatric hospital radio show to become the nation’s favourite breakfast show DJ on BBC Radio 1. His is a life lived on and off air. And this book is a combination of both. It’s funny, honest and gives Chris a platform to talk about his favourite subject… himself.
